This is a great opportunity for a PR Account Manager, with a strong background in corporate and financial communications, to join a team of professionals with an exemplary knowledge of workings of financial markets, the media and regulators.
The team is embedded within a multidisciplinary consultancy, so there is the opportunity to work on broader communications campaigns with a diverse team of experts.
The team have an unrivalled track record handling communications for big name clients across all industry sectors, so there is the opportunity to work broadly across a blend of different clients. While the client portfolio is hugely impressive client contact is high at all levels and responsibility is given quickly to those who demonstrate the are capable operators.
The standout feature of the firm is its genuine investment and interest in its people. Training, development and support is excellent; their strong retention record is testament to this.
Responsibilities
- Working with senior team members to formulate strategies.
- Driving communications plans and the preparation of messaging materials e.g. key messages, presentations, scripts, press releases, Q&A, fact sheets.
- Daily contact with financial journalists
- Regular client contact, often acting as the first port of call and advice giver
- Mentoring junior team members
Requirements
- 2-4 years PR agency experience, or in an in-house financial and corporate communications role
- A strong interest in and knowledge of finance and investment; a thirst for news and current affairs
- Excellent written skills
- Entrepreneurial and gregarious
- Able to juggle multiple tasks and responsibilities
